My new fave is Clinique's Almost Powder. I have super-oily skin, so everything looks cakey on me if I'm not careful. My second fave is Laura Mercier's tinted moisturizer.

The best foundation, though, is the kind that works with your skin. I think it's harder to find a formula that works with skin type than it is to find the right color. It's worth it to go to Sephora or someplace where you can talk to an expert, get a sample, and most importantly, take it back if it doesn't work!!
